Shubman Gill attains career-best 4th spot in ODI rankings | Cricket News – Times of India


NEW DELHI: India opener Shubman Gill jumped one place to realize his career-best fourth place within the newest ICC ODI Participant Rankings launched on Wednesday.
Gill is the most effective Indian batter amongst prime 10 with Virat Kohli making a one place rise to be at sixth and Rohit Sharma remaining static at eighth within the checklist led by Pakistan skipper Babar Azam.
Among the many prime 10 bowlers in ODIs, pacer Mohammed Siraj continues to be the lone Indian to function within the checklist as he maintained his quantity three spot, behind Australian fast Josh Hazlewood and New Zealand’s Trent Boult.
South Africa’s Aiden Markram gained 13 spots to succeed in forty first place within the batting chart and 16 locations to thirty second within the all-rounders’ checklist, one other career-best feat in each the departments as South Africa beat the Dutch 2-0 of their three-match collection in Johannesburg.

They edged nearer to automated qualification for the ICC Males’s Cricket World Cup in India later this 12 months.
Different positive aspects have been made by New Zealand’s Henry Nicholls, who climbed two spots to 69 within the batting rankings and his teammate Will Younger, who leaped 60 spots to a private finest 143rd following their 2-0 collection victory over Sri Lanka.
Matt Henry stood out for the Black Caps, leaping 5 slots to occupy the fifth spot within the bowling rankings, whereas South Africa’s Sisanda Magala introduced himself with a 35-place leap to his personal career-best quantity one hundred and sixty fifth after taking eight wickets in two matches, together with a maiden five-wicket haul towards the Netherlands.
Suryakumar continues to guide T20I rankings
In T20I Participant Rankings, Suryakumar Yadav retained his prime place amongst batters, whereas Hardik Pandya remained static on second within the all-rounders’ checklist.
Bangladesh’s Litton Das rose one spot to succeed in twenty first place, his highest profession rating thus far, sharing the spot with New Zealand’s Daryl Mitchell, who climbed 5 locations from 26. That is additionally Mitchell’s career-best rating whereas his earlier finest was twenty fifth.
Sri Lanka’s Kariyawasa Asalanka is tied with Scotland’s George Munsey for twenty third place after leaping 12 spots.
Within the bowling rankings, Maheesh Theekshana has risen three spots to tenth whereas Bangladesh’s Taskin Ahmed has gone up three locations to thirty sixth.
